Police: Tiburon Parks Commissioner Embezzled Thousands from Napa Winery

Police accuse the Marin man of stealing $30,000 from the business accounts of Thomas Knoll Winery.

By Bay City News Service:

The chair of the Tiburon Parks, Open Space and Trails Commission has been charged with embezzling money from a Napa winery where he worked as a bookkeeper, a Napa police lieutenant said.

Peter Winkler is suspected of withdrawing $30,000 from the business accounts of Thomas Knoll Winery between October 2013 and October 2015, Lt. Patrick Manzer said.

The business owners confronted Winkler about the missing money and Winkler was arrested in Marin County. He later posted bail and was released.

Napa police sent their investigation of the case to the Napa County District Attorney's Office in January, Manzer said.

Winkler, 61, of Tiburon, is scheduled to be arraigned April 28 in Napa County Superior Court. He is still a member of the Tiburon Parks, Open Space and Trails Commission, a spokeswoman said Monday morning.

Winkler was not immediately available for comment Monday morning.
